See New York City thru the eyes of photographers Mike Matzkin and Jonathan Karl Matzkin
Mike and Jonathan Karl Matzkin are father and son photographers with different approaches but a similar passion for New York City. Mike has extensive experience as a professional photographer and has had successful careers in newspapers and trade magzines as well as in public relations with Canon and Nikon. Enjoy Sunday night music in Peru
The Town of Peru Concert Series continues on Sunday, August 21st with the music of Towne Meeting. Towne Meeting is a 5-member band with powerful vocal harmonies. History, science, Tony Bennett and Dream Girls lovers should enjoy this trip
The Clinton County Senior Citizens Council is sponsoring a trip to Baltimore and Annapolis from October 13th to October 16th, 2011. It features a live Tony Bennet concert, a dinner theater Dream Girls production and tours of Annapolis Naval Academy, Fort McHenry, the Maryland Science Center and much more. NCUGRHA Annual Meeting
The North Country Underground Railroad Historical Association will hold its 5th Annual Meeting, June 26, 3-5 pm, at the Ausable Valley Grange Hall, 1749 Main St., Keeseville, NY.
